  • Patent number: 10167861
    Abstract: The present invention is provided to suppress occurrence of free flow. An infusion pump includes: a sliding clamp closing and releasing an infusion tube; a pump body including a tube attachment portion to which the infusion tube is to be attached detachably and forcibly transferring liquid in the infusion tube; and a door pivotably supported by the pump body so that the tube attachment portion is openable and closable by the door. The pump body includes: a clamp attachment portion into which the sliding clamp having the infusion tube set therein is to be inserted and set; and a release operator being operated in the clamp attachment portion to transfer the sliding clamp from a close mode to a release mode, the release operator being configured to be locked, in response to opening movement of the door, so that the release operator is inoperable for releasing, and to be unlocked in response to closing movement of the door.

  • Patent number: 8555152
    Abstract: An electronic pasting method for pasting electronic data in consideration of printed and written data, including updating pasted data when electronic data is updated after it is pasted. The electronic pasting method uses a detecting unit and a paste information updating unit. The detecting unit detects a paste stroke made over two print sheets filled to denote a user's pasting action with which part or whole of a printed matter of electronic document information is pasted on printed matter, then detects the pasting action from a set of paste strokes, thereby obtaining a paste-from document, a paste-to document, and a paste position according to the pasting action detected by the detecting unit. The paste information updating unit updates the e-document, the printed matter information, and the written information according to the above paste information.

  • Patent number: 8209297
    Abstract: For hierarchical data including tuples each including a combination of different data types and lists each listing data of a same data type, corresponding attribute-based data divided by attribute is stored in attribute-based files whereas information on the structure of the hierarchical data is held as schema information. The schema information includes data type information on the hierarchical data structure, including data type information on each element of each tuple and data type information on only a top element of each list. The attribute-based files storing the attribute-based data are managed to be in order by a file name management table. Data on each attribute is stored in a file in a state of being hierarchized in a list format corresponding to the depth at which the each attribute is listed in the schema information.

  • Patent number: 7907797
    Abstract: This invention provides an efficient image processing apparatus having merits as the handiness and visibility of paper and the multi-functionality of a computer, enabling trial and error with paper media without capturing all images previously. The apparatus comprises an image capturing unit for electronically capturing paper images by a photo-sensor; an image editing unit for editing such as clipping of partial image or scaling; a user interface unit for receiving user's commands regarding the image editing; an image memory unit for storing; and an image display unit for displaying the images in the image memory unit. An image displaying function is provided on a transparent plane. Photo-sensors are on the plane, and image capturing unit and image display unit are integrated to form an image capturing and display unit. A user gains an operability compatible with human instinct, ignoring a difference between paper and electronic medium.

  • Patent number: 7783634
    Abstract: A device for recording positions within an electronic document and capable of recreating those recorded positions afterwards even if the electronic document has been changed to some extent. An index data creation unit in an information terminal creates index information for a page to display from the electronic document, and records it along with time information in an index database. When a time is specified, the index data search unit searches the index database for index information recorded near that time, and identifies the page position of that electronic document from the searched index information. A data display unit displays the beginning of the electronic document at the identified position. The information terminal is capable of managing information by linking electronic data from handwritten information written on paper with a digital pen, with the display page the electronic document by utilizing a stroke set database and a pen data processor.

  • Publication number: 20070291325
    Abstract: An image display device according to the present invention is disclosed wherein a display function is added to an area sensor in which an optical sensor (constituted by a thin film light sensing diode) and a TFT are disposed in two dimensions on a transparent substrate to form a read function. Pixels each having a read function are each provided with a light transmitting area, and the thin film light sensing diodes and the TFTs are each formed using a substantially transparent material, so that the device itself is transparent. Therefore, a user can directly see the contents of a printed matter while the area sensor is placed on the printed matter. Further, an image can be read by, for example, designating the image required for the user from above the device. Consequently, it is possible to decrease the power consumption of the device.

  • Patent number: 7231601
    Abstract: A digital pen-based application form filling system with a modification prevention function, which eliminates a possibility that digital information initially written in digital paper using a digital pen may be modified deliberately or accidentally. The system prints a new fine pattern over areas in already written digital paper whose contents one wishes to protect against being modified. This printing adds a fine pattern to an original dot pattern already present on the digital paper to make it theoretically impossible to enter information into these areas using the digital pen.
